Output 6e933816d7b8224f21562fa183b2b74eefb198a974f360841c6619676463a022:18

value
50000907
script pubkey
OP_0 OP_PUSHBYTES_20 ef03bc27c2ef734b3fd10db56a053961eeafddb0
address
bc1qaupmcf7zaae5k073pk6k5pfev8h2lhdshek934
transaction
6e933816d7b8224f21562fa183b2b74eefb198a974f360841c6619676463a022
spent
true